Donut Island (ドーナッツ島, Dōnattsu Shima) is a location which appears in Suikoden IV. It is a small island located in the south-eastern Island Nations.

Information

This deserted island is located within an archipelago of small islands located east of the Kingdom of Obel. It is called Donut Island because of its unique appearance, being formed as a ring of rocky terrain and coral reefs.

There were rumors of hidden treasure being buried on this island, resulting in many treasure hunters visiting in search of wealth. During the Island Liberation War, the treasure hunter Rene was found divining the location of such treasures on this island.
